引言
随着信息技术的飞速发展,计算机科学已经成为现代教育体系中不可或缺的一部分。计算机教育硕士(Master of Education in Computer Science Education,简称MECSE)课程应运而生,旨在培养既懂计算机科学又懂教育的复合型人才。本文将深入探讨计算机教育硕士课程的背景、课程设置、职业前景以及其对教育领域的影响。
背景与意义
1. 计算机科学与教育的融合趋势
随着计算机技术的广泛应用,教育领域对计算机科学知识的需求日益增长。计算机教育硕士课程应运而生,旨在培养能够将计算机科学与教育理念相结合的人才。
2. 培养复合型人才
计算机教育硕士课程注重跨学科融合,旨在培养学生在计算机科学和教育领域的双重能力,使他们能够在教育领域发挥更大的作用。
课程设置
1. 核心课程
- 计算机科学基础
- 教育心理学
- 教学设计与方法
- 教育技术与应用
- 课程开发与评估
2. 专业课程
- 计算机编程
- 数据结构与算法
- 网络与信息安全
- 人工智能与机器学习
- 教育游戏设计与开发
3. 实践课程
- 教学实习
- 研究项目
- 教育技术产品开发
职业前景
1. 教育领域
- 中小学信息技术教师
- 教育技术顾问
- 教育项目管理者
2. 企业领域
- 教育软件开发工程师
- 用户体验设计师
- 教育产品经理
影响与启示
1. 促进教育创新
计算机教育硕士课程的开设,有助于推动教育创新,为学生提供更加丰富、个性化的学习体验。
2. 培养适应未来社会需求的人才
计算机教育硕士课程培养的学生具备跨学科能力,能够更好地适应未来社会的发展需求。
3. 推动教育信息化
计算机教育硕士课程在推动教育信息化方面发挥着重要作用,有助于提高教育质量和效率。
结语
计算机教育硕士课程作为一种跨学科的教育模式,为教育领域注入了新的活力。随着科技的不断进步,计算机教育硕士课程将继续发挥重要作用,为培养适应未来社会需求的人才贡献力量。
